2010-07-08 58 views
0

我想開發一個數據驅動的WPF應用程序,它使用WCF連接到服務器端,它本身使用NHibernate來存儲數據。例如,有一個名爲「Customer」的域對象,並且還有一個被稱爲「GetCustomer(int customerId)」的WCF操作返回的「CustomerDTO」(使用Automapper)。SOA中客戶端更新的模式

我不知道我應該做的數據驗證,我應該如何處理客戶端的更新,這樣就可以通過編輯形式,最後點擊「保存」修改客戶端上的單個或多個屬性.. 。

能否請您爲我提供了在這種情況下一些常見的模式或最佳初步實踐的例子,其對象實際LOB應用程序(n層的圖案,多層等)

回答

0

聽起來像一個非常適合Self Tracking Entities。請注意,STE的媒體熱度很高,而且還有一些更成熟的事情要做。與他們一起使用的方法應該回答你的常見模式問題。